How to Lighten Hair Color That Is Too Dark

1. Wash with Clarifying Shampoo

One of the simplest ways to lighten hair color is by using a clarifying shampoo. These shampoos are designed to remove buildup and can help strip away some of the excess dye.

  • Use Regularly: Wash your hair with clarifying shampoo a few times a week.
  • Follow with Conditioner: Clarifying shampoos can be drying, so apply a good conditioner afterward.
  • Results: You may notice a gradual lightening effect after several washes.

2. Try Baking Soda and Shampoo

A natural method involves mixing baking soda with your regular shampoo. This combination can help lift the color.

  • Mixing Ratio: Combine equal parts baking soda and shampoo.
  • Application: Massage into your hair and leave it for 5-10 minutes before rinsing.
  • Frequency: Use this method 2-3 times a week until you achieve the desired lightness.

3. Use Vitamin C Treatment

Crushed vitamin C tablets mixed with shampoo can also help lighten hair.

  • Preparation: Crush 10-15 vitamin C tablets into a fine powder.
  • Mix and Apply: Mix with a small amount of shampoo and apply to damp hair.
  • Wait Time: Leave the mixture on for 30-60 minutes, then rinse thoroughly.

4. Apply a Hair Color Remover

If natural methods don’t work, consider using a hair color remover. This product is specifically designed to strip artificial color from your hair.

  • Choose the Right Product: Look for a product that suits your hair type and color.
  • Follow Instructions: Carefully follow the manufacturer’s instructions for the best results.
  • Condition Well: Hair color removers can be harsh, so deep condition your hair afterward.

5. Seek Professional Help

If home remedies don’t achieve the desired result, consult a professional stylist. They can offer treatments like:

  • Color Correction: A stylist can adjust your hair color to better match your expectations.
  • Highlighting: Adding highlights can break up the dark color and create a softer look.

How long does it take for hair color to fade?

Hair color naturally fades over time, typically within 4-6 weeks, depending on the type of dye used and your hair care routine. Using color-safe shampoos and conditioners can help maintain the color longer, while clarifying shampoos can accelerate fading.

How can I prevent my hair color from turning too dark in the future?

To prevent hair color from turning too dark, choose a shade lighter than your desired color when dyeing at home. Always conduct a strand test before applying the dye to your entire head. Additionally, follow the recommended processing times and instructions carefully.
